We’re gearing up for a thrilling Brasileirão Série A match as Palmeiras goes up against Vitoria. The game kicks off at 23:30 local time at the famous Allianz Parque in São Paulo. Palmeiras have been strong this season, sitting in second place and hot on the heels of the league leaders. They’re looking to tighten their grip on the top spots. Meanwhile, Vitoria is struggling down in 17th place. They’re fighting hard to climb out of the relegation zone.
Palmeiras have shown grit and skill in recent games. They’ve won three of their last five matches (L, L, W, W, W). However, they stumbled in their last match, losing 0-1 to Santos FC. The team’s attack is led by the outstanding Vitor Roque. He’s scored an incredible 16 goals this season. On the other hand, Vitoria’s form has been up and down (D, W, L, L, W). They managed a 0-0 draw against Botafogo RJ in their last outing. Renato Kayzer stands out for Vitoria, netting eight goals so far.
Looking back at past meetings, Palmeiras have had the upper hand against Vitoria. They’ve stayed unbeaten in four of the last five encounters, winning three and drawing one. With a 60% win ratio and nine goals scored to just three conceded in these games, Palmeiras will want to make the most of their home advantage.

Home Team vs Away Team Head-to-Head Statistics
Palmeiras have led the recent head-to-head battles against Vitoria, winning three of the last five matches. Vitoria managed one surprise win, and the teams drew once. Their latest matchup ended in a 2-2 tie last August, highlighting Vitoria’s grit. They’ve previously managed an unexpected win at Allianz Parque in July 2024, showing their upset potential.
| Date | Fixture | Score |
|---|---|---|
| 2025-08-03 | Vitoria vs Palmeiras | 2 – 2 |
| 2024-07-27 | Palmeiras vs Vitoria | 0 – 2 |
| 2024-04-14 | Vitoria vs Palmeiras | 0 – 1 |
| 2018-12-02 | Palmeiras vs Vitoria | 3 – 2 |
| 2018-08-19 | Vitoria vs Palmeiras | 0 – 3 |
